Bhubaneswar: Another 10,881 COVID-19 patients have recovered and are being discharged on Friday, informed the State Health & Family Welfare Department.
Here is the district-wise recovery count:-
- 1559 from Khordha
- 1440 from Sundargarh
- 883 from Cuttack
- 522 from Anugul
- 455 from Sambalpur
- 411 from Bargarh
- 385 from Mayurbhanj
- 368 from Kalahandi
- 347 from Nayagarh
- 333 from Puri
- 311 from Ganjam
- 303 from Baleswar
- 303 from Nuapada
- 284 from Nabarangpur
- 263 from Jagatsinghpur
- 262 from Jharsuguda
- 231 from Bhadrak
- 198 from Bolangir
- 196 from Dhenkanal
- 194 from Sonepur
- 183 from Rayagada
- 176 from Keonjhar
- 175 from Koraput
- 151 from Boudh
- 137 from Kendrapara
- 119 from Jajapur
- 109 from Kandhamal
- 108 from Deogarh
- 84 from Gajapati
- 59 from Malkangiri
- 332 from State Pool
With more than 10K COVID-19 patients being discharged today, the total recovered cases of Odisha now stands at 5,67,382, said the H & FW Dept.
